Baked Millet Biscuits is a traditional Kenyan recipe for a classic biscuit (cookie) made with a mix of sorghum and wheat flour with margarine and sugar that are oven baked until golden. The full recipe is presented here and I hope you enjoy this classic Kenyan version of: Baked Millet Biscuits.

Ingredients:
100g sorghum (or pearl millet) flour
100g wheat flour
115g margarine
150g white sugar
1 egg
1/2 tsp baking powder
1/2 tsp salt
1/2 tsp vanilla extract
Method:
Cream the margarine and sugar together then beat-in the egg. Add the flours along with all the other dry ingredients and cream to a smooth batter. Place the batter in a refrigerator over night then roll out on a cold board to a thickness of about 6mm and cut into rounds using a pastry cutter.
Place these on a greased baking tray and bake in an oven pre-heated to 200°C (400°F/Gas Mark 6) for about 10 minutes, or until golden brown all over.
